Nestled in a suburban area of Liverpool, Mossley Hill Train Station is a quaint and pivotal stop along the Northern line. It offers the quintessential experience of a local station, promising an easy transition between residential life and the broader bustle of the United Kingdom. The station serves as a critical junction for both residents commuting to bustling urban centers and visitors exploring the charm of Liverpool.
Despite its modest nature, Mossley Hill does well to accommodate the needs of its passengers. It offers convenient ticket purchasing options, including a ticket office with opening hours from Monday to Saturday, 5:50 AM to 11:45 PM and Sunday, 8:30 AM to 11:15 PM. There are ticket machines available for collecting pre-booked tickets, albeit not specifically designed for accessibility. If you need assistance with your journey, staff can be found at the station during their working hours, or you might also consider using the helpline at 08002006060.
For accessibility, the station provides step-free access and seating areas. While there are no waiting rooms, the seating areas offer a place to rest amidst your travels. Keep in mind, however, that facilities such as accessible toilets, refreshment kiosks, and ATMs are not available here, nor are there any retail or exchange services. Cyclists can find storage for up to 8 bicycles within the station car park, though the storage area isn't sheltered.
Mossley Hill offers a seamless connection to other modes of transport, making it a gateway to further exploration. For anyone needing to catch a bus, the rail replacement service pickups are located at the bus stops on Rose Lane, near the Tesco Express store. Taxi information is available via the website Taxis, making planning onward travel a breeze. While the station note mentions bicycle hire as available, unfortunately, there aren’t current hire facilities directly at the station.
Assistance is just a phone call away, with Busline available at 0871 200 2233 to guide you toward the right bus service, ensuring you remain connected and on the move.

Sanderstead Train Station is a cozy spot in the Southern Rail network, nestled in the London Borough of Croydon. It serves as a convenient gateway for commuters and leisure travelers alike, offering an array of facilities to enhance your journey. Whether you're planning a trip to the bustling streets of London's West End or a calm escape to nearby countrysides, Sanderstead is a solid starting point.
Sanderstead Station provides a variety of amenities designed to make traveling as smooth and comfortable as possible. Offering a comprehensive ticket office which is open from the early morning until past midnight every day, travelers can purchase tickets whenever they need. Should you prefer the convenience of online purchases, tickets can be easily collected at the station’s ticket machine even if you require accessible features.
For those who require assistance, Sanderstead is well equipped with facilities for disabled passengers, including induction loops and staff-operated ramps to aid boarding—a must-mention for travelers with mobility challenges. To ensure a trouble-free experience, it's recommended to pre-book assistance two hours prior to your journey.
Although the station lacks waiting rooms and accessible toilets, you'll find seating and rest areas. Refreshment facilities along with some shopping options are available for a quick bite or last-minute needs. While public Wi-Fi is not on offer, payphones are installed for communication purposes.
Sanderstead station proudly incorporates safety and accessibility into its design. It boasts CCTV surveillance to ensure passenger security around the clock, and while there’s an ongoing effort to improve facilities, some areas like accessible cars and taxis may still have limitations.
The station car park, managed by APCOA, is open 24 hours and offers free parking with dedicated accessible spaces. Cyclists are catered for too with 56 bicycle storage spaces located conveniently with CCTV coverage to provide peace of mind.
Once you're ready to move on from Sanderstead, you'll find a range of transport links to extend your journey. The local bus network, details of which can be found in the station's 'Onward Travel Information Map', connects the station with surrounding areas. In case of rail service disruptions, rail replacement buses are available to ensure your travel plans remain intact.
